Leica Geosystems has announced the latest update of its leading monitoring software Leica GeoMoS. GeoMos v5.1 features the the first compact plug and play solution from Leica Geosystems, the M-Com series. M-Com allows reliable and seamless monitoring communication integrating Total Stations, GNSS receivers and antennas, geotechnical sensors, software, and IT communication infrastructure...more |

Leica Geosystems updates its GNSS quality control and data analysis software. Leica SpiderQC v4.0 is part of the new reference station software update that also includes Leica GNSS Spider and Leica SpiderWeb. SpiderQC (previously known as GNSS QC) adds a range of advanced features for multi-frequency, multi-GNSS data analysis, visualization, and numerous other new features, improvements, and optimizations. |
